Verse Chords
The verse of "Istana Bintang" typically follows this chord progression:
C G Am F
This sequence is repeated throughout the verses. Practice transitioning smoothly between these chords. Try strumming each chord four times before moving to the next. This will help you establish a steady rhythm and develop your muscle memory.

Chorus Chords
The chorus of the song uses a similar progression, but with a slightly different feel. The most common progression is:
F C G Am
This section usually has a bit more energy, so you might want to strum a bit harder or faster. Experiment with different strumming patterns to find one that you like and that fits the song. For example, you could try a down-down-up-down-up pattern, or a more syncopated rhythm with some muted strums.
In addition to strumming patterns, you can also add variations to the chords themselves. Try adding a seventh to the G chord (G7) to create a more bluesy feel, or use a different voicing of the F chord to add some color. Experiment with different techniques and see what sounds best to your ear.

Strumming Pattern
A basic strumming pattern that works well for "Istana Bintang" is:
Down, Down, Up, Down, Up
Experiment with this and find what feels right for you. The rhythm should be consistent and steady. A good way to improve your strumming is to practice with a metronome, gradually increasing the tempo as you become more comfortable.
To add more variation to your strumming, try incorporating some muted strums or ghost notes. These are created by lightly touching the strings with your strumming hand, producing a percussive sound without a distinct pitch.
